Derby Day Chocolate Chip Cookies

A soft, buttery chocolate chip cookie with a taste reminiscent of a certain famous Derby Day pie. Lots of pecans and chocolate chips!

Preparation Time
20 mins
Cooking Time
10 mins
Total Time
30 mins
Calories
111 Calories

Recipe Instructions

Step 1
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
Step 2
Stir together flour, baking soda, and salt in a medium bowl with a fork. Set aside.
Step 3
Beat together butter, brown sugar, and white sugar in a large bowl until smooth. Beat in e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Mix in bourbon. Stir in flour mixture just until blended. Fold in pecans and chocolate chips until evenly distributed. Drop by large spoonfuls onto ungreased baking sheets.
Step 4
Bake in the preheated oven until the edges are lightly browned, about 10 minutes. Cool cookies on the baking sheets for 1 minute, then remove to wire racks to cool completely.

Ingredients

  • 2 eggs
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 cup butter, softened
  • 1 cup packed brown sugar
  • 5 tablespoons Kentucky bourbon
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 0.5 cup white sugar
  • 2.25 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1.5 cups chopped pecans
  • 1.5 cups semisweet chocolate chips
